Is there a time limit for funding?
Yes, you set your own deadline. Your fundraiser can last up to 120 days. The most successful fundraisers run for a period of 2 to 6 weeks. Donors are more inclined to give when there is a sense of urgency and a short time frame.
What happens if the goal isn’t reached by the end of the fundraiser?
We send the funds as they are donated so you always receive all the funds that have been donated in real time, minus the fee PayPal or WePay charges for processing the credit cards. YouCaring does not charge any fees for the use of our website.

What is PayPal / WePay?
PayPal and WePay are services that enable users to pay, send and receive payments while keeping your financial information hidden.
They are both used by millions of people around the world and are known to be among the safest and securest payment platforms.
Note - You must have a verified and confirmed PayPal Premier account to use PayPal.
You can 'verify' your account by logging into PayPal and clicking the 'Get Verified' link.
IMPORTANT: Becoming 'Verified' means successfully linking your bank account to PayPal in order to verify your identity. There are two ways to accomplish this: a) verify your bank account instantly on PayPal or b) PayPal will make a test deposit into the bank account you provide - this may take up to 3 days to complete.

Are contributions tax-deductible?
Donations made on YouCaring.com are generally not tax-deductible because you are usually not giving directly to a 501(c) 3 non-profit organization with a government issued EIN Tax ID #. Please consult your own tax adviser on any giving you may do on YouCaring.com. Any money going to YouCaring.com is also not tax deductable. YouCaring.com is an LLC with a goal to be a mission driven social venture. YouCaring helps those who typically have a difficult time raising money: those that are not non-profits or 501(c) 3 compliant. YouCaring.com wants the fundraiser to receive 100% of your donation. Non-profits spend up to 40% of their resources fundraising. That means less time for programs that are behind their missions. That can also mean that only 60% of your donations make it to their intended purpose. Our goal is to make YouCaring.com the most efficient form of fundraising available.
How much of each donation goes to the beneficiary?
The total amount, minus the PayPal or WePay processing fee (typically 2.9% + a $.30 transaction fee). There are no website fees.
